DIY Mini-ITX Laptop - Update & Basic Details
Last month I gave people a sneak peek at my DIY laptop project at AmiWest (and youtube). It's been several weeks since, so it's high time that I gave you more information. The video above gives a quick update (I'm almost done assembling a large 3D printer for prototyping), and details on the usual questions: what, who, etc.
